Bonnie Lee (Talkington) Long, 69, of Oakland, passed away on August 25, 2026, at her residence with her family by her side. Born on June 6, 1957, in Washington, D.C., she was the daughter of the late Roy and Olive Talkington.

Bonnie was a wonderful caregiver who dedicated herself to residential home care with UCP, offering patience, kindness, and steady support to those in her care. She found joy in simple, loving work at home as well: cooking and baking, especially for her family; decorating for every season; and stitching, cross-stitching, and other crafts. Above all, she treasured her relationship with God and time spent with her family.

She is survived by her daughter, Jessica Dawn Buzzard, and husband, Larry Werner; grandchildren, Devin Pierce, Jaron Weimer and wife Kaelee, and Morgan Weimer; great-grandchildren, Rhett and Beckett Weimer; siblings, Alice Estep and husband Bill, and Darriel Talkington and wife Sabrina; and sister-in-law, Mary Talkington.

In addition to her parents, she was preceded in death by her son, Joshua Ray Buzzard; and siblings, Ruth Mickey, David Talkington, and Daniel Talkington.

A celebration of life will be announced at a later date.
